    realme goes to Davao to take the world “up close”

    From picturesque landscapes to mouthwatering dishes, there are tons of reasons why Davao city is the “crowned jewel” of Mindanao—a truth realme got to witness firsthand.

    Celebrating its fifth year anniversary, realme flew to Davao City to launch its Mastershot Photowalk series powered by its most recent smartphone with a 200MP main camera, the realme 11pro+ 5g. 


    The photowalk, followed by a tour of the Malagos Chocolate Museum, gave fans a close up view of the authentic beauty of Davao wildlife and nature conservation.

    The camera’s AI Scene Enhancement feature paired with the SuperiorOIS camera is a boon for photo walks. Street photographers can zoom up close with no trouble seeing clear details with the 2x and 4x zooming options. The OIS hardware feature built into the camera allows for hardware image stabilization so you avoid blurry images, especially when zoomed close and pressing the shutter button.

    “Na-enjoy ko rin yung experience ng may nakikita kang ibang texture, ibang lighting, at may kasama kang tao–’Yung nagshoshoot ka pero hindi ka mag-isa,” lifestyle and celebrity photographer Stephen Capuchino said.

    Photowalk attendees also got to experience the device’s new camera features such as the Street Mode option, where the user can experiment with different filters.

    “For me, it’s about experiencing the camera, the tool. And to try it out in a space na conducive to creativity. Basically, they’re encouraging the people to be creative—and I love that,” said local street photographer Miguel Lisbona.

    For capturing the moment

    The tour within the grounds of Malagos Garden Resort allowed attendees to get a close-up encounter with colorful flora and fauna.

    “I would recommend this phone for specific activities like travel, family gatherings. May wide lens for that one and the selfie camera is also good,” Capuchino said.

    Selfies are immensely popular among Filipinos, and the 11pro+ 5g’s 32 megapixel Sony Front Camera does get the fine finish result. While the beauty effect is seen to need more improvement, Capuchino does not see it as a downside.

    “Sometimes kasi yung mga leading brands natin, masyadong heavy yung filter. This one—hindi siya gaanong ka-aggressive,” He added.

    Lisbona carried the same sentiment, saying that Realme has made a product accessible to people who want to “experience the flagship sensor” in a mid-range phone. 

    “Realme wants to cater to that segment, and the bottomline is really their creativity. They want to encourage people to experience it para ma-enhance pa ‘yung creativity [nila],” Lisbona added.

    Moreover, Capuchino said that realme’s contribution in the mobile photography arena is the gradual yet sure innovations through its products. 

    “Hindi siya nagmamadali na magbigay sa atin ng something new na magiging fad lang. Yung binibigay niya sa atin ay something na magagamit mo agad,” He said.

    To top off the Davao trip, realme also hosted the Fanfest 2023 at SM Lanang Premier, where fans got serenaded by The Juans and local band Tatot Music.

    Davao is the second-leg of this year’s realme Fanfest, which launched in Clark, Pampanga.
